Lori Falzarano

  • Class
    1989
  • Induction
    1999
  • Sport(s)
    Softball

   Lori Falzarano played softball for FDU from 1987-90. While on the team she was named FDU-Madison Female Co-Athlete of the year in 1989-90. Falzarano was a three-time team MVP, earning that honor in 1988, 1989, and 1990. She was selected first team All-MAC in 1988 as a pitcher. Falzarano is the career record-holder in several categories. With 569 strikeouts, she has struck out more opponents than any other FDU softball pitcher. She has pitched the most innings of any FDU player at 837.1. Her 128 games played and 74 wins also are all-time bests. Falzarano is second on the career list with 2.13 earned run average. After graduation, Falzarano began working for the Veterans Administration Hospital in Basking Ridge, NJ as a Recreational Therapist. She has continued to work at the hospital and has been there for nine years.
